### Ticket: Signature check failing in Paylark integration tests

The nightly integration suite for Paylark has been flaky all week, and today it's outright failing on the webhook signature step. Looks like the sandbox rotated its signing key but our test fixtures still pin the old one, so every verify call bounces. Not a prod issue, but it's blocking merges. Fix is to swap the pinned key in the fixtures. For reference, the new sandbox key is below.

signing key of bagap-yawep = bky13_TbfT6ZMUoGJo2

## Deployment

The Gleanwick sweeper runs as a scheduled job that deletes orphaned volumes and stale load balancers left behind by failed deploys. It operates under a scoped service account with delete rights limited to resources tagged by our provisioner; it cannot touch tagged-protected resources. All deletions are logged immutably before execution. The job is configured entirely through the values below.

deployment values, bagap-kagap:
OLIIX_HOST=oliix.qorvellabs.internal
OLIIX_PORT=8000

Handover for tonight: the Lattice component library cut v9 this afternoon, and a few consumer apps still pin v8 ranges. If builds fail on peer dependency errors, that's the cause — don't force-resolve. The publishing pipeline reads its version policy from one place, and the current values are these.

deployment values, taduf-fawig:
WENAEL_HOST=wenael.zemvarlabs.internal
WENAEL_PORT=8443

// Heads up for whoever's on call: these constants control how often
// Plovermill polls the config service for hot-reloads. If reloads seem
// stuck, it's almost always the debounce window, not the poller itself.
// Bump values cautiously — too aggressive and we hammer the service,
// too lazy and stale config lingers for minutes. Current settings are as follows.

constants for kageg-bawif:
QUOTAS = {
    "quenwyn": 1,
    "oliix": 10,
}